Infobox Standard title New Spanish Two Step comment image image size caption writer Traditional composer lyricist Bob Wills Tommy Duncan published written language English form Western swing original artist Bob Wills and His Texas Playboys recorded by many, many other artists performed by New Spanish Two Step is a Western swing Standard music standard based on a traditional fiddle tune, Spanish Two Step, ref McWhorter, Cowboy Fiddler , p. 59 60 Bob said, He played The Spanish Two Step and I locked the door where he couldn t get out and nobody else could get in, and I made him stay there until he taught me that and Maiden s Prayer. Finally he nodded. I didn t know whether he needed to go to the bathroom or if I was doing it right, bit I let him out. That Mexican taught him those two tunes. ref which was one of Bob Wills and His Texas Playboys signature songs. Wills and his vocalist, Tommy Duncan , added lyrics to reflect the title I told her I had to go, Left her down in Mexico, The band played Spanish Two Step soft and low. New Spanish Two Step became one of the Playboy s greatest hits. It was first recorded by Bob Wills and His Texas Playboys Columbia 36966 in 1946, staying on the charts for 23 weeks and reaching 1. ref Whitburn, The Billboard Book of Top 40 Country Hits , p. 392. ref The b side, Roly Poly song Roly Poly , was also a big hit, reaching 3. File Two of the Natives of New Holland, Advancing to Combat.jpg frameless right Two of the Natives of New Holland, Advancing to Combat is a drawing by Sydney Parkinson , drawn in 1770 and published posthumously in 1773. It is the earliest known portrayal of an Australian Aborigine by a Europe an, and a typical example of a painting in the noble savage ideal, showing proud warriors, bravely advancing in defence of their land. The stance of the warriors is said to be based upon the Borghese Gladiator . Category 1773 works Category 1770s paintings Category Australian paintings painting stub ... more details

refimprove date September 2011 The Northern New South Wales Football League Division Two or the NewFM Football League , NewFM First Division Football League or just the NewFM Division for sponsorship reasons, is an Australia n football soccer league in the North of New South Wales . It is the second tier of football in the Northern New South Wales Football 2 tier system behind the NBN League . The players in the league are mostly semi professional . Format The NewFM Division shares similarities with the way in which the NBN League is played, but it also has some differences. The competition consisted of 12 teams, each of whom have a 1st Grade side, a Reserve side and a Youth side. The regular season takes place over 22 rounds, with each team playing each other at home and away. The team that finishes first at the end of the 22 rounds is crowned Minor Premier. The top 4 teams contest the Finals Series. This is a two legged match where 1st plays 4th and 2nd plays 3rd. The teams that progress meet in the Grand Final and the winner of that game is crowned the Major Premier. The Minor Premier of the League is promoted to the NBN League if the club meets the eligibility criteria. Decision sciences involves those disciplines primarily dealing with the decision ...Unreferenced date December 2009 science The term behavioural sciences encompasses all the disciplines that explore the activities of and interactions among organism s in the natural earth world . It involves the systematic analysis and investigation of human and animal behaviour through controlled and naturalistic observation, and disciplined scientific experimentation. It attempts to accomplish legitimate, objective conclusions through rigorous formulations and observation E.D. Klemke, R. Hollinger & A.D. Kline, eds. 1980 . Examples of behavioural sciences include psychology , cognitive science , and anthropology . Difference between behavioural sciences and social sciences The term behavioural sciences is often confused with the term social sciences . Though these two broad areas are interrelated and study systematic processes of behaviour, they differ on their level of scientific analysis of various dimensions of behaviour. The life sciences comprise the fields of science that involve the scientific study of living organism s, like plant s, animal s, and human being s. Life Science is also affected by bioethics While biology remains the centerpiece of the life sciences, Technology technological advances in molecular biology and biotechnology have led to a burgeoning of specializations and new, often interdisciplinary , fields.
